VIP gift box for VIP Porsche owner

Porsche China creates a specialty gift box for owners of its new, limited-edition Porsche 918 Spyder to convey luxury and customer care.

Porsche China wanted to develop a VIP Roadside Care package for owners of their new Hybrid Supercar, the 918 Spyder. Their aim was that “when opening the package, the customer should know they are cared for and receive a welcoming surprise.”

Taking cues from grooming products, airlines, spas, hotels, resorts, and luxury department stores, the design team at Swedbrand Ltd. aimed to define the type of experience Porsche’s customers would enjoy and expect from a care package. Next, the team focused on luxury packaging cues, like interaction, sound, accessibility, feel, closure, heritage, anticipation, finishing, and quality. These cues were then translated into material, finishing, structural, and graphic design concepts.

Porsche’s limited-edition, handmade paper bag and rigid gift box set coincided with the launch of the limited-edition 918 Spyder—a truly exclusive vehicle. And now, according to Porsche, when the owner receives a limited-edition VIP Roadside Care package, they will feel just as exclusive as their new 918 Spyder.

Says Jing Zhou, Supervisor After Sales Marketing for Porsche, “We are targeting the 918 Spyder owners, a special group that owns the most unique and most high-end model of Porsche. Their expectations are pretty high toward the brand. We needed to understand how to make them perceive Porsche customer care as special and unique as their cars. Swedbrand succeeded well in creating a premium and unique gift package that perfectly fits into the brand image and exceeds our expectations.”
